Glowing EyeShadow From Coast Southwest

Phase Phase A

Creaspheres DIM WL 4 Black (Coast Southwest) (Créations Couleurs) (Polymethylsilsesquioxane (and) CI77499)
9.50

BNpoly WL12 Black (Coast Southwest) (Créations Couleurs) (Boron Nitride (and) CI77499)
9.50

Magnesium myristate
3.00

Nylonpoly LL WL 10 (Coast Southwest) (Créations Couleurs) (Nylon-12 (and) methicone (and) lauroyl lysine)
3.00

Talcpoly LL (Coast Southwest) (Créations Couleurs) (Talc (and) lauroyl lysine (and) methicone)
10.00

Creaspheres EL WL 7 (Coast Southwest) (Créations Couleurs) (Vinyl dimethicone/methicone silsesquioxane crosspolymer (and) polymethylsilsesquioxane)
3.00

Phase Phase B

Colourmat White R LL (Coast Southwest) (Créations Couleurs) (Mica (and) titanium dioxide (and) methicone (and) lauroyl lysine)
5.00

Colourmat Black R LL (Coast Southwest) (Créations Couleurs) (Mica (and) CI77499 (and) methicone (and) lauroyl lysine)
28.30

Phase Phase C

Phenoxyethanol (Coast Southwest) (Sharon Laboratories)
0.50

Sodium dehydroacetate
0.15

Dissolvine NA2-S (Coast Southwest) (AkzoNobel Functional Chemicals, LLC) (Disodium EDTA)
0.05

Alphaflow 40 (Coast Southwest) (Créations Couleurs) (Hydrogenated polydecene)
3.00

Phase Phase D

Creastar Melanosis Silver WL 80 (Coast Southwest) (Créations Couleurs) (CI77499 (and) talc (and) calcium aluminium borosilicate (and) silver (and) hydrogenated meadowfoam seed oil (and) tin oxide calcium aluminium borosilicate (and) CI77891 (and) tin oxide (and) CI77266)
15.00

Creastar Metalwhite (Coast Southwest) (Créations Couleurs) (Calcium aluminium borosilicate (and) CI77891 (and) tin oxide (and) CI77266)
10.00

PROCEDURE:
Mix ingredients in phase A together until homogeneous. No heating necessary. Add phase B into phase A and mix until homogeneous. Add phase C into the mixture (A+B) and mix until homogeneous. Add phase D into the mixture (A+B+C) and mix until homogeneous.

Stimulsense After Shave

Phase Phase A

Water
82.30

Tetrasodium glutamate diacetate, sodium hydroxide, water
0.20

Glycerin
2.00

Phase Phase B

Dicaprylyl ether
4.00

Arcylates/C10-30 alkyl acrylate crosspolymer
0.50

Polymethylsilsesquioxane
2.00

Phase Phase C

Oleth-20
1.00

Dicaprylyl ether
2.00

Phase Phase D

NaOH, 10% solution
1.00

Fragrance
q.s.

Caprylhydroxamic acid, glyceryl caprylate, methylpropanediol
1.00

Pentylene glycol
2.00

Sensfeel (Provital, S.A./Centerchem)
2.00

PROCEDURE:
In vessel, add components of phase A separately with mixing at room temperature. Mix until uniform. In separate vessel, add components of phase B. Mix until uniform. Add phase B into phase A while mixing at high shear. In a separate vessel, add components of phase C with mixing. Mix until uniform. Add phase C to phase A/B while mixing at high shear. Add components of phase D separately with gentle mixing at temperatures <40C to main batch. Mix until uniform.

Soft Touch Clear Body Spray

Phase Phase A

SD alcohol 40-B (Colonial Chemicals) (Alcohol denat.)
80.00

Sylvasol 200 (Arizona Chemical) (Polyamide-7)
3.00

Glycerin
4.00

Propylene glycol
2.00

DC Toray FZ-3196 (Dow Corning) (Caprylyl methicone)
4.00

Tween 80 (Croda) (Polysorbate 80)
4.00

Phase Phase B

Fragrance
3.00

PROCEDURE:
Blend all phase A raw materials together and heat to 40°C with agitation until Sylvasol 200 is fully blended in (15 minutes). Remove from heat and add phase B fragrance. Mix until uniform.

PROPERTIES:
Stable at RT (25°C) for 2 months. Fragrance used was women’s fragrance from Ascent Aromatics

Silicone Free Color Protect Shampoo

Phase Phase A

Water
q.s. to 100

Miracare SLB365 (Rhodia) (Water, sodium trideceth sulfate, sodium lauroamphoacetate, cocamide MEA)
40.0

Camelia oil
3.00

Jaguar C17 (Rhodia) (Guar hydroxypropyltrimonium chloride)
0.40

Ionol CP (BHT) (Shell Chemicals)
0.05

Parsol MCX (DSM) (Octyl methoxycinnamate)
0.18

Fragrance
0.20

Sodium chloride (20% solution)
10.0

Sodium benzoate
0.50

Citric acid (50%)
2.00

PROCEDURE:
Charge water and Miracare SLB-365 into main vessel and mix until uniform. In a separate vessel, blend oil, Ionol CP, Jaguar C17, Parsol MCX and fragrance until uniform. Increase the mixing rate of the main vessel to 300 rpm. Charge premix in main vessel. (5 min at 300rpm & 10 min at 150 rpm). Charge sodium benzoate and sodium chloride into main vessel and mix until uniform (about 15 min). Adjust pH of the system to 4.5-5.0 with citric acid and mix for 60 Min.

PROPERTIES:
Appearance—White “lotion-like” solution; Brookfield Viscosity at 25°C—Up to 10 000 mPa.s (RVT, spindle 4, 10 rpm); pH @ 25°C—4.5 to 5.0; Storage-Stability—Stable for 3 months (Freeze/Thaw; 45°C; 4°C).

Silky Face Moisturizing Lotion

Phase Phase A

Deionized water
68.55

Pricerine 9091 (Croda, Inc.) (Glycerin)
7.00

Euxyl PE 9010 (Schülke & Mayr GmbH) (Phenoxyethanol (and) ethylhexylglycerin)
0.80

Structure CEL 4400 E (AkzoNobel Global Personal Care)(Hydroxyethyl ethylcellulose)
0.15

Phase Phase B

Arlacel 165 (Croda, Inc.) (Glyceryl stearate (and) PEG-100 stearate)
2.00

Lipol-VOL A (Lipo Chemicals) (Refined avocado oil) (Persea gratissima (avocado) oil)
3.00

Dermol IPM (Alzo Inc.) (Isopropyl myristate)
5.00

Floramac Macadamia Oil (Floratech) (Refined macadamia integrifolia seed oil)
3.00

Emcon Sun - Org (Fanning Corp) (Helianthus annuus (sunflower) seed oil)
3.00

Dow Corning 200 Fluid (5 CST) (Dow Corning Corp.) (Dimethicone)
1.00

Phase Phase C

Carbopol 940 (Lubrizol Advanced Materials)
0.20

Phase Phase D

Deionized water
1.00

Triethanolamine-99% (Ashland Chemical)
0.30

Phase Phase E

Dry-Flo TS starch (AkzoNobel Global Personal Care) (Tapioca starch polymethylsilsesquioxane)
5.00

PROCEDURE:
In main beaker, add deionized water, glycerin, and Euxyl PE 9010. Mix on Silverson homogenizer at low to moderate speed (2000-3000 rpm) and begin heating to 75-80°C. Sprinkle in Structure CEL 4400E and homogenize at low to moderate speed (2000-3000 rpm) until fully hydrated. In a side beaker, add phase B ingredients and mix on propeller @ 300 rpm. Heat to 75-80°C. Once phase A and phase B reach desired temperature, add Phase B to phase A with homogenization at 4000 rpm. Mix for 10 minutes, then begin cooling to 65°C. When batch reaches 60-65°C, sprinkle in Carbopol and homogenize at 4000 rpm for 10 minutes until hydrated. Continue batch mixing at 4000 rpm and pre-mix Phase D. Add to main batch after Phase C has mixed and fully hydrated for 10 minutes. Cool batch to 45°C. Continue batch mixing at 4000 rpm. Once phase D is fully dissolved, add phase E and mix until dispersed and uniform. Switch batch to overhead sweep mix blade at low speed (20 rpm) and cool to 25°C.

PROPERTIES:
pH—6.90-7.40; Appearance—white cream; Viscosity 16000-24000 cps (Brookfield RVT, Spindle C, Speed 10, 1 minute).

Water-Based Acrylic Nail Polish

Phase Phase A

Syntran PC 5620 (Interpolymer) (Styrene/acrylates methacrylates copolymer)
84.65

Ammonium hydroxide (28%)
0.35

Phase Phase B

Benzoflex 9-88 (Genovique) (Dipropylene glycol dibenzoate)
2.40

Dowanol PnB (Dow) (Propylene glycol n-butyl ether)
4.40

Syntran KL-219CG (Interpolymer) (Ammonium acrylates copolymer)
1.20

Phase Phase C

12.5% aqueous solution of Laponite XLS (Rockwood/Southern Clay) (Sodium magnesium silicate and tetrasodium pyrophosphate)
3.00

Phase Phase D

Solid pigment or pigment dispersion
4.00

PROCEDURE:
Add Syntran PC 5620 to batch tank. With constant agitation, slowly add 28% ammonium hydroxide. In a separate vessel, premix phase B with appropriate agitation. Slowly add phase B to phase A with constant agitation. Stir for 30 minutes and avoid aeration. Separately prepare a 12.5% wt/wt aqueous solution of Laponite XLS. Stir until clear and fully hydrated. Add phase C to batch and stir for 15 minutes. Add phase D to batch and stir with appropriate agitation to disperse pigment.

PROPERTIES:
pH—7.8-8.6; Solids—46-48%.
